Parallel Verses

New American Standard Bible

Poor is he who works with a negligent hand,
But the hand of the diligent makes rich.

King James Version

He becometh poor that dealeth with a slack hand: but the hand of the diligent maketh rich.

Holman Bible

Idle hands make one poor,
but diligent hands bring riches.

International Standard Version

Lazy hands bring poverty, but hard-working hands lead to wealth.

A Conservative Version

He who works with a slack hand becomes poor, but the hand of the diligent makes rich.

American Standard Version

He becometh poor that worketh with a slack hand; But the hand of the diligent maketh rich.

Amplified


Poor is he who works with a negligent and idle hand,
But the hand of the diligent makes him rich.

Bible in Basic English

He who is slow in his work becomes poor, but the hand of the ready worker gets in wealth.

Darby Translation

He cometh to want that dealeth with a slack hand; but the hand of the diligent maketh rich.

Julia Smith Translation

A slothful hand makes poverty, and the hand of the active will make rich.

King James 2000

He becomes poor who has a slack hand: but the hand of the diligent makes rich.

Lexham Expanded Bible

A slack hand causes poverty, but the hand of the diligent enriches.

Modern King James verseion

He who deals with a lazy hand becomes poor; but the hand of the hard worker makes rich.

Modern Spelling Tyndale-Coverdale

An idle hand maketh poor; but a quick laboring hand maketh rich.

NET Bible

The one who is lazy becomes poor, but the one who works diligently becomes wealthy.

New Heart English Bible

He becomes poor who works with a lazy hand, but the hand of the diligent brings wealth.

The Emphasized Bible

He becometh poor, who dealeth with a slack hand, but, the hand of the diligent, maketh rich.

Webster

He becometh poor that dealeth with a slack hand: but the hand of the diligent maketh rich.

World English Bible

He becomes poor who works with a lazy hand, but the hand of the diligent brings wealth.

Youngs Literal Translation

Poor is he who is working -- a slothful hand, And the hand of the diligent maketh rich.
